The Legal Landscape Is Always Changing — Why Trusted Legal Guidance Matters

In Kenya, the law is not static. Court decisions, policies, and procedures are constantly evolving, often in ways that directly affect individuals and businesses. What was acceptable or lawful yesterday may no longer apply today.

A recent example is the clarification by the High Court that personal injury claims arising from road traffic accidents are not suitable for the Small Claims Court, even where the value of the claim falls below the monetary limit. This development has left many claimants uncertain about where they stand — especially those with pending cases or judgments already delivered.

This is not unusual. Legal change is part of the justice system. The challenge is knowing how those changes affect you and what steps to take next.


Why Keeping Up with Legal Changes Is Important

Legal compliance is not optional. Whether you are:

  • Filing a claim,
  • Defending a case,
  • Executing a judgment, or
  • Making decisions based on existing policies,

acting on outdated information can expose you to unnecessary risk, delay, or cost.

Court decisions can:

  • Change jurisdictional rules
  • Affect how ongoing cases are handled
  • Determine whether a judgment remains enforceable
  • Influence compliance requirements for individuals and businesses

Without proper guidance, it can be difficult to tell whether a change applies to your specific situation.
